Product Description:
The 1911-2301-151-070 Floppy Disk Drive (FDD) Unit supports both Double Density (720 KB) and High Density (1.44 MB) floppy disks. It is designed for industrial applications. It fits standard 3.5 inch PC/AT drive bays. The unit offers reliable data transfer with low power consumption.
This FDD unit features a 3.5 inch form factor that complies with PC/AT 3.5" drive bay dimensions of approximately 102 mm × 25 mm × 146 mm. The casing is constructed from metal that ensures durability in industrial environments. Its front bezel is made of industrial grade plastic for enhanced longevity. The drive provides a flush front panel mounting with a secure locking mechanism. Mounting screws are positioned at standard locations for easy integration into industrial enclosures. It utilizes a standard 34 pin FDD connector for data transmission and a 4 pin Berg connector for a + 5 V DC power supply. The front panel includes a protective dust proof door, a manual eject button and a status LED indicator. The unit operates at an input voltage of + 5 V DC and consumes approximately 1.0 W during idle and between 2.0 W to 2.5 W when active. The data transfer rate is maintained at 500 Kbps. Its rotational speed is fixed at 300 RPM that ensures stable and accurate data reading and writing.
The 1911-2301-151-070 FDD unit from Okuma supports magnetic storage using standard 3.5 inch floppy disks. It offers 80 tracks per side that enables efficient storage organization. For the High Density (1.44 MB) format, it supports 18 sectors per track. The encoding method used is MFM (Modified Frequency Modulation) which ensures reliable data encoding and decoding.
